non port: net/relayd/Makefile |
Number of commits found: 64 |
Monday, 22 Jan 2024
|
15:50 Muhammad Moinur Rahman (bofh)
net/relayd: Sanitize MANPREFIX
Approved by: portmgr (blanket)
064cf48 |
Monday, 16 Oct 2023
|
14:33 Mateusz Piotrowski (0mp)
net/relayd: Update to 7.3.2023.05.09-p5
This release fixes relayd on recent 15.0, where the pf(4) ioctls has
changed.
Sponsored by: Modirum MDPay
Sponsored by: Klara, Inc.
78bd6ba |
Thursday, 27 Jul 2023
|
10:09 Mateusz Piotrowski (0mp)
net/relayd: Update to 7.3.2023.05.09-p4
This release provides builds fixes for FreeBSD 12.
MFH: 2023Q3
Sponsored by: Modirum MDPay
Sponsored by: Klara Inc.
c7dafea |
Wednesday, 26 Jul 2023
|
16:11 Mateusz Piotrowski (0mp)
net/relayd: Update to 7.3.2023.05.09-p3
MFH: 2023Q3
Sponsored by: Modirum MDPay
Sponsored by: Klara Inc.
7725c05 |
Monday, 19 Jun 2023
|
12:20 Mateusz Piotrowski (0mp)
net/relayd: Update to 7.3.2023.05.09-p2
This version is in sync with the relayd version present in the OpenBSD
main branch as of 2023.05.09.
While here:
- Switch to a new repository where FreeBSD relayd is now maintained.
This is where we moved many of the port's patches to clean up the
files/ directory.
- Take maintainership as agreed via email with the current maintainer.
Sponsored by: Modirum MDPay
Sponsored by: Klara, Inc.
Co-authored-by: Dave Cottlehuber <dch@FreeBSD.org>
c9ba90c |
Saturday, 29 Apr 2023
|
15:14 Muhammad Moinur Rahman (bofh)
net/relayd: Mark BROKEN_SSL
- Fails to build with OpenSSL 3.0.0 and later
Approved by: portmgr (blanket)
594d40b |
Monday, 20 Feb 2023
|
10:50 Antoine Brodin (antoine)
net/relayd: mark BROKEN
ca.c:241:19: error: variable has incomplete type 'RSA_METHOD' (aka 'struct
rsa_meth_st')
Reported by: pkg-fallout
343002f |
Wednesday, 7 Sep 2022
|
21:10 Stefan Eßer (se)
Add WWW entries to port Makefiles
It has been common practice to have one or more URLs at the end of the
ports' pkg-descr files, one per line and prefixed with "WWW:". These
URLs should point at a project website or other relevant resources.
Access to these URLs required processing of the pkg-descr files, and
they have often become stale over time. If more than one such URL was
present in a pkg-descr file, only the first one was tarnsfered into
the port INDEX, but for many ports only the last line did contain the
port specific URL to further information.
There have been several proposals to make a project URL available as
a macro in the ports' Makefiles, over time.
This commit implements such a proposal and moves one of the WWW: entries
of each pkg-descr file into the respective port's Makefile. A heuristic
attempts to identify the most relevant URL in case there is more than
one WWW: entry in some pkg-descr file. URLs that are not moved into the
Makefile are prefixed with "See also:" instead of "WWW:" in the pkg-descr
files in order to preserve them.
There are 1256 ports that had no WWW: entries in pkg-descr files. These
ports will not be touched in this commit.
The portlint port has been adjusted to expect a WWW entry in each port
Makefile, and to flag any remaining "WWW:" lines in pkg-descr files as
deprecated.
Approved by: portmgr (tcberner)
b7f0544 |
Tuesday, 1 Mar 2022
|
14:13 Fernando Apesteguía (fernape) Author: Steve Wills
net/relayd: fix build
While here, pet linters.
PR: 262004
Reported by: swills@FreeBSD.org
Approved by: koue@chaosophia.net (maintainer)
MFH: 2022Q1 build fix
b4d94c7 |
Wednesday, 7 Apr 2021
|
08:09 Mathieu Arnold (mat)
One more small cleanup, forgotten yesterday.
Reported by: lwhsu
cf118cc |
Tuesday, 6 Apr 2021
|
14:31 Mathieu Arnold (mat)
Remove # $FreeBSD$ from Makefiles.
305f148 |
Friday, 11 Dec 2020
|
16:13 jbeich
security/libressl: re-link static library consumers after r557713
|
Friday, 4 Sep 2020
|
10:53 se
Fix build with -no-common
While here make the substitution of %%PREFIX%% operational (again?).
It has probably been lost due to make makepatch generating patch files
after the substitution by the actual prefix has been performed in the
post-patch target.
To prevent this issue in the future, the substitution of %%PREFIX%%
by the actual prefix is moved in to the post-configure phase, since the
configure command does not rely on the substitution having been performed.
|
Saturday, 9 May 2020
|
03:46 tobik
Rebuild statically linked security/libressl consumers after r534416
|
Monday, 16 Dec 2019
|
08:27 pi
net/relayd: fix build if SSL_DEFAULT is libressl
PR: 239860
Submitted by: koue@chaosophia.net (maintainer), franco@opnsense.org
|
Saturday, 19 Oct 2019
|
15:00 tobik
Rebuild statically linked security/libressl consumers after r514815
|
Sunday, 26 May 2019
|
16:11 swills
net/relayd: fix build on 12/CURRENT
While here, assign maintainer to submitter and clean up formatting a
little
PR: 236657
Submitted by: Nikola Kolev <koue@chaosophia.net>
|
Friday, 29 Mar 2019
|
13:18 garga
Fix maintainer e-mail address
|
Monday, 18 Mar 2019
|
22:47 mm
Drop maintainership of net/relayd
I don't have the will, time and resources to continue maintaining this.
|
Tuesday, 30 Oct 2018
|
20:51 mm
net/relayd: mark as BROKEN on FreeBSD 12 and HEAD
|
Sunday, 26 Aug 2018
|
08:16 delphij
net/relayd: Stop using arc4random_stir
PR: 230830, 230756
Approved by: portmgr (antoine)
|
Wednesday, 15 Mar 2017
|
14:45 mat
Remove all USE_OPENSSL occurrences.
Sponsored by: Absolight
|
Tuesday, 24 May 2016
|
19:45 lme
Bump PORTREVISION after the last commit that changed the relayd rc script.
Reported by: junovich
Approved by: maintainer timeout (11 months)
|
Thursday, 7 May 2015
|
18:52 antoine
Unbreak
|
17:26 mat
Update ports in the n* categories to not use GH_COMMIT.
With minor cleanups to make things simpler.
With hat: portmgr
Sponsored by: Absolight
|
Thursday, 19 Mar 2015
|
16:44 bdrewery
Update USE_GITHUB so it does not require GH_COMMIT.
Using this new scheme allows only setting the _tag_ or _commit hash_ in
GH_TAGNAME and not having to know the hash for a tag. This scheme will
download a tarball that has a different checksum than before due to a changed
directory name for extraction.
The following MASTER_SITES are provided to retain the old checksum and
directory structure (that require GH_COMMIT):
GH -> GHL
GITHUB -> GITHUB_LEGACY
Differential Revision: https://reviews.freebsd.org/D748
Submitted by: amdmi3
Reviewed by: mat, swills, antoine, bdrewery
With hat: portmgr
|
Thursday, 15 Jan 2015
|
09:05 tijl
Add missing USE_OPENSSL=yes
PR: 195796
|
Sunday, 10 Aug 2014
|
20:12 mm
Update relayd to 2014-08-10
|
Monday, 4 Aug 2014
|
19:55 mm
Update relayd to 5.5.20140730
PR: 192260
|
Thursday, 24 Jul 2014
|
13:32 bapt
Only use libevent2
Remove libevent as libevent2 is providing a good compatibility interface as well
as providing better performances.
Remove custom patches from libevent2 and install libevent2 the regular way
Mark ports abusing private fields of the libevent1 API as broken
Import a patch from fedora to have honeyd working with libevent2
Remove most of the patches necessary to find the custom installation we used to
have for libevent2
With hat: portmgr
|
Friday, 13 Jun 2014
|
11:47 matthew
* USES=uidfix -- staging without needing root access
* Don't install relayd.conf to staging; switch to @sample in pkg-plist
* Drop warnings for FreeBSD 7.x compat as that's long out of support
* Modernize LIB_DEPENDS
* Fix LICENSE: this is OpenBSD code, but it uses the ISC Licence
wording rather than either of the {2,3}-clause BSD licenses.
Approved by: portmgr (blanket "just fix it")
|
Saturday, 31 May 2014
|
16:37 ak
- Fix various distinfo errors
- Remove unused USE_* knobs
- Convert USE_TWISTED_RUN to USES
- Remove empty lines after .include <bsd.port.mk>
Approved by: portmgr (antoine)
|
Sunday, 19 Jan 2014
|
12:44 mm
Fix pkg-plist for relayd
|
12:19 mm
Fix pkg-plist for relayd
|
12:07 mm
Add STAGE support to net/relayd
|
Friday, 22 Nov 2013
|
07:36 mm
Update to 5.4.20131122
Fixes bug: automatic retry in msgbuf_write on EAGAIN causes spinning.
|
Thursday, 24 Oct 2013
|
20:24 mm
Switch to USE_GITHUB infrastructure
|
Wednesday, 23 Oct 2013
|
22:51 mm
Update to 5.3.20131024 and unbreak on FreeBSD 10
|
Monday, 30 Sep 2013
|
14:23 bdrewery
- Remove default DISTNAME
PR: ports/165609
Submitted by: pgollucci (March 2012)
With hat: portmgr
|
Friday, 20 Sep 2013
|
22:10 bapt
Add NO_STAGE all over the place in preparation for the staging support (cat:
net)
|
Saturday, 14 Sep 2013
|
17:13 mm
Mark as BROKEN on head until fixed
|
Saturday, 4 May 2013
|
22:48 flo
Fix installation of ports that rely on cp -n for installing files. r245960
changed cp to exit with a non-zero exit code if the file exists and is not
overwritten thus causing ports to fail installing when e.g. trying to cp
.default -> .conf files that already exist.
We just ignore the error and continue, as we used to.
Reported by: jaset
Approved by: portmgr (bapt)
|
Monday, 31 Dec 2012
|
10:49 mm
Update some of my ports to new options framework
Submitted by: Baptiste Daroussin <bapt@FreeBSD.org>
|
Thursday, 22 Nov 2012
|
11:27 mm
Update to 5.2.20121122
Feature safe: yes
|
Monday, 5 Mar 2012
|
16:29 mm
Update to 5.1.20120305
|
Wednesday, 7 Sep 2011
|
12:14 mm
Update relayd to 5.0.20110907
FreeBSD port is now developed at https://github.com/mmatuska/relayd
|
Wednesday, 8 Jun 2011
|
17:38 pav
- Mark BROKEN on 7.X: does not build
: undefined reference to `arc4random_buf'
Reported by: pointyhat
|
Monday, 6 Jun 2011
|
18:19 mm
- Add patches for OpenBSD bugs 6624 and 6627
- Switch to USERS and GROUPS framework
|
Saturday, 28 May 2011
|
09:46 mm
- Start relayd earlier in rcorder
|
Thursday, 26 May 2011
|
18:48 mm
- Update to 4.9.20110526 (and unbreak check_script)
|
Sunday, 22 May 2011
|
22:14 mm
Update to 4.9.20110522
|
Wednesday, 23 Mar 2011
|
15:53 mm
- Add LICENSE knob(s)
|
Saturday, 15 Jan 2011
|
00:26 mm
Import patches from upstream:
- fix open sockets limit for health check
- only set SO_REUSEPORT for listening ports
Feature safe: yes
|
Sunday, 25 Jul 2010
|
15:39 mm
Update libevent to 1.4.14b
PR: ports/147723
Approved by: maintainer (timeout)
|
Wednesday, 9 Jun 2010
|
20:58 mm
- Fix SSL session id callback error (seed random before chroot) [1]
- Use IP_BINDANY if supported
- Update distfile
PR: ports/129859 [1]
Reported by: umoorjani.msv@gmail.com [1]
|
Monday, 31 May 2010
|
09:45 mm
- Import relayctl runtime log verbosity setting from OpenBSD
- Import event handling change from OpenBSD
- Bump PORTREVISION
|
Sunday, 30 May 2010
|
18:39 mm
- Build only with OSVERSION => 702104
Reported by: pointyhat (pav)
|
Saturday, 29 May 2010
|
08:44 mm
- Fix SSL certificate paths to PREFIX
- Add relayd.conf.sample
- Bump PORTREVISION
|
Friday, 28 May 2010
|
11:59 mm
- Update to 4.6.20090813
- Backport several patches from OpenBSD 4.7 and newer
- Fix build with FreeBSD 7 (arc4random.c)
- Fix user and group creation in pkginstall
- Add reload command to startup file
- Enable optional static build with libevent
- Take maintainership
PR: ports/147122
Approved by: kuriyama (private e-mail)
|
Tuesday, 6 Jan 2009
|
17:59 pav
- Remove conditional checks for FreeBSD 5.x and older
|
Tuesday, 19 Aug 2008
|
16:40 mnag
- Update libevent dependency and bump PORTREVISION
|
Tuesday, 8 Apr 2008
|
15:57 gahr
- Fix build on sparc64 and amd64
Approved by: maintainer (timeout), miwi (mentor)
|
Tuesday, 19 Feb 2008
|
21:06 pav
- Mark BROKEN on amd64: does not compile
Reported by: pointyhat
|
Sunday, 20 Jan 2008
|
21:38 kuriyama
OpenBSD's Relay Daemon (previously known as hoststated).
relayd is a daemon to relay and dynamically redirect incoming
connections to a target host. Its main purposes are to run as a
load-balancer, application layer gateway, or transparent proxy. The
daemon is able to monitor groups of hosts for availability, which is
determined by checking for a specific service common to a host group.
WWW: http://spootnik.org/relayd/
# This port will work on $OSVERSION >= 700049.
# If you want to use on RELENG_6, apply a patch in
#
http://www.openbsd.org/cgi-bin/cvsweb/src/sys/net/pf_table.c.diff?r1=1.67&r2=1.68
|
Number of commits found: 64 |